logo

Output 1ac586feb71deb17b52cb6836944027cebe221f64679bc9474b0614c00d98eb9:1

value
2518302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52161eaaaa144b0f31e3ce844a5a7bf773ed1ab6 OP_EQUAL
address
39B3qBcwcGjQTPAs5219pLRzrSFFMNR3eg
transaction
1ac586feb71deb17b52cb6836944027cebe221f64679bc9474b0614c00d98eb9